Diaz v. CarMax Auto Superstores California, LLC et al

Filing 16

ORDER VACATING MAY 13, 2015 HEARING AND STAYING DEFENDANTS MOTION TO DISMISS AND MOTION TO STRIKE AND SETTING HEARING ON PLAINTIFF'S MOTION TO REMAND. THE COURT SETS A MOTION HEARING as to 13 MOTION to REMAND BACK to STATE COURT for 6/10/2015 at 10:00 AM in Courtroom 9 (SAB) before Magistrate Judge Stanley A. Boone. Signed by Magistrate Judge Stanley A. Boone on 4/22/2015. (Hernandez, M)
